Detail | Information |
---|---|
Full Name | Lesley Ann Warren |
Date of Birth | August 16, 1946 |
Place of Birth | New York, New York, USA |
Occupation | Actress, Producer |
Known For | Her roles in various films and television shows, including Victor/Victoria (1982) and her portrayal of Cinderella. |

What Made the Victor/Victoria Role So Special for Lesley Ann Warren?
Among her many notable roles, Lesley Ann Warren's part in the film Victor/Victoria stands out as particularly significant. This movie, released in 1982, presented her with a unique and rather intriguing character to bring to life. The story itself involves a struggling female soprano in 1934 Paris who finds work only after posing as a man, which is quite a premise, anyway. For an actress, taking on a role that involves such a complex deception and exploring themes of identity and performance within a performance, offers a lot of interesting challenges. It requires a nuanced understanding of the character's motivations and the ability to convey both vulnerability and strength, often at the same time.
Her work in Victor/Victoria showcased her ability to handle a role that was both comedic and dramatic, requiring a delicate balance. The film itself was well-received, and her contribution to its success was certainly recognized.
